Mrs. Mary Ellen Jackson, 79, of Dalton passed away Monday, March 26, 2018 at Emory Saint Josephs Hospital in Atlanta.
She was the daughter of the late Elmer and Ludell Bridges of Monroe , GA. and brother, Elmer
“Moe” Bridges of Albany, GA.
She grew up in Monroe, Georgia where she was the Drum Major for the Monroe Drum and Bugle Corp. from 1954-1956 and then raised her family in Dalton, Georgia. She found her calling in being a mother and grandmother and also enjoyed, and was active in her church.
Mary Ellen is survived by her loving husband of 55 years, Marvin Jackson of Dalton, GA, son, Jay Jackson and his wife, Lori of Sandy Springs; daughter, Sherry Jackson of Chamblee, GA; daughter, Karen Whaley and her husband, Kelly and their children, Andrew Whaley and Allison Whaley of Cohutta, GA; son, Michael Jackson and his wife, Becky Jackson and their children, Ansley Jackson, Riley Jackson and Abby Jackson of Suwanee, GA; brother, Ricky Bridges of Bostwick, GA; she is also survived by many brother and sister in laws, nephews, nieces, cousins, and other close family and friends, all of whom she valued greatly throughout her life.
Services will be Friday at 2 p.m. in the chapel of Dalton First Baptist Church with Rev. Larry Flanagan and Rev. Jonathan Barlow officiating.
The family will receive friends in the atrium of the church on Friday from 11:30 a.m. until the service at 2 p.m.
Graveside services will be on Saturday at 1 p.m. at Center Hill Baptist Church Cemetery in Gratis, Georgia.
